DUTIES:

This position is located at the US Naval Academy Preparatory School in Newport, Rhode Island.

Serve as an assistant Football coach, supporting the Head Football coach at the Naval Academy Preparatory School (NAPS).

This is a 10-month position from July-May every year, with benefits continuing on through the summer months. The incumbent will be on LWOP status for two months.

The Assistant Football coach, under the guidance of the NAPS Director of Athletics, helps in development and improvement in football of the athletes to include practice planning, in -game support and coaching and training programs.

Responsible for oversight and monitoring Coast Guard Academy preparatory candidates assigned to NAPS.

Support the NAPS Athletics Director, performing duties assigned such as operations and administrative support.

Report back to USCGA Director of Athletics and Director of Admissions (and their designees) on status of USCGA candidates assigned at NAPS on a regular basis.

Other duties as assigned.

QUALIFICATIONS REQUIRED:

Minimum:

1. Collegiate football experience

2. Knowledge of NCAA rules and regulations

3. Bachelors Degree

Preferred: (In addition to the minimum qualifications):

1.Collegiate or HS Football Coaching experience

2. Demonstrated experience in recruiting athletically talented, academically qualified and diverse student athletes to an academically rigorous institution
